- In article <1993Jan6.061050.2855@walter.cray.com> rl@ferris.cray.com (Randy Lambertus) writes:
- >
- > I down loaded the file, but when I try to open it from Paintworks Gold,
- >I get the error 004A. The file was on my hard drive. I then moved it
- >to a floppy, and the error changed to 004B. These errors both refer to
- >version levels? The HD is formatted under 6.0, and I am booting PW Gold
- >from it's own launcher program. Maybe my PW copy is hosed? Does anyone
- >know how to configure PW Gold to run under 6.0 on the HD? Did it
- >reqire an upgrade that I never got? I will have to dig out the original
- >PW Gold disk and make a new backup and try that one.
-
- Error 004A means "incompatible file format", it's probably because
- PW Gold is unable to display multi-palette animations (I can't verify
- this, since I don't have PW Gold, but this is my guess.) Jason Harper's
- AniShow will play all animations, and if you like I'll post it BSQed
- to c.b.a2 or email a copy to you. DreamGrafix, FinderView 3.0 and
- Platinum Paint v2.0 will also play multi-palette animations.
